How does shot composition affect storytelling?

Shot composition plays a crucial role in the art of filmmaking, as it has the power to influence and enhance storytelling. The way shots are framed and arranged within the frame can evoke specific emotions, create atmosphere, and convey important narrative information. For instance, a close-up shot of a character's face displaying subtle expressions can convey their inner thoughts or feelings, while a wide shot can show the grandeur of the environment, setting the tone for the story. Additionally, the placement of characters or objects within the frame can visually suggest relationships, power dynamics, or foreshadowing. By utilizing shot composition effectively, filmmakers can effectively guide audiences through a story, stimulate their emotions, and effectively convey the intended message.
